CS II" in SETUP MAIN MENU with or cursor button. 2. Press the OK button to enter this menu. 3. Press or cursor button to select desired item. 4. Press or cursor button to set the level. 5. When you select "TO MAIN MENU" by pressing the or button, you can return the SETUP MAIN MENU by pressing the OK button . Or press the or cursor button to select "EXIT" then press the OK button to exit the SETUP MENU. TRUBASS: Set the TRUBASS level between 0 and 6 level in 1 level interval with or cursor button. TRUBASS produced by the speakers to be an octave below the actual physical capabilities of the speakers adding exciting, deeper bass effects. SRS DIALOG: Set the SRS DIALOG level between 0 and 6 level in 1 level interval with or cursor button. This can be popped out of the surround audio effects allowing the listener to easily discern what the actors say. If "NONE" was selected for the Center speaker setting in the Speaker size, then this setting will not appear. MENU STRUCTURE of CS II setup 5.CS II setup TRUBASS 0 6 SRS DIALOG 0 6 TO MAIN MENU EXIT exit SETUP MENU 24 6. 6.1 CH INPUT LEVEL This sub-menu is to adjust the speaker levels for 6.1-channel input sources. Here you will adjust the volume for each channel so that they are all heard by the listener at the same level. 4. 5. BASS SETUP/T.TONE M-CH ST 7 2CH 8 F.DIRECT A/D 0 6.1CH -IN 9 OFF MENU 1. 3. 5. S-DIRECT OK MUTE NIGHT VOLUME 2. 5. 1. Select "6. 6.1 CH IN" in SETUP MAIN MENU with or cursor button. 2. Press the OK button to enter this menu. 3. Press or cursor button to select desired channel. 4. Using the or cursor button, adjust the volume level of each channel. Maximum +10dB 1 dB interval Reference 1 dB interval +9dB 0dB -9dB button button Minimum -10dB 5. When you select "TO MAIN MENU" by pressing the or button, you can return the SETUP MAIN MENU by pressing the OK button . Or press the or cursor button to select "EXIT" then press the OK button to exit the SETUP MENU. Note: • The condition of these setup will be memorized to 6.1CH INPUT source.
